Don't look at Witthas's beauty on stage, she is a real "godmother" figure. Even our Chinese god Ning Feng has studied under her! This educational talent is simply admirable.

When it comes to Weithaas's background, it's really a copy of a "musical family". Her teacher, Wiener Salz, was a descendant of Joseph Joachim, who in turn was Mendelssohn's protégé. This chain of music inheritance is simply a string of brilliant pearls!
